Transaction 62fc3640f227aebd57e4e533af0bf435332019f0e28e23c5ec2091a2d3bce1d8

1 Input
2 Outputs
  • 62fc3640f227aebd57e4e533af0bf435332019f0e28e23c5ec2091a2d3bce1d8:0
  • value  291542
    address  155dGsyhCZD3P7trmx9f5JPFpAEihZCzgM
  • 62fc3640f227aebd57e4e533af0bf435332019f0e28e23c5ec2091a2d3bce1d8:1
  • value  520042
    address  1GHXnFzHcSZ1abkwenTJZn9GvL2aJKCxof